Mike Wallace plays Jazz guitar with a style similar to Stanley Jordan. His performance is absolutely hypnotic. You look up at the clock and an hour has passed before you realize it. He chooses his setlist from several CDs of original songs plus a few Jazz interpretations of rock songs.

"Nationally recognized Moline native Mike Wallace has been referred to as a musical 'master of all trades'. His fingerstyle guitar compositions or 'Wallytunes' refuse to be pigeonholed into any one style. Mike combines the many influences of jazz, blues, ragtime and rock and roll with alternate guitar tunings making each arrangement uniquely his own. It’Äôs been said he plays like he has 20 fingers on each hand. He has played guitar professionally since the age of 12 and also plays banjo, mandolin and pedal steel and his newest acquisition, a Dyer harpguitar from the early 1920's." - findusat309.com
